- The distance between Vicksburg, Mississippi, Usa and Tadotsu, Japan is approximately 11,260 km or 6,997 mi.
- To reach Vicksburg, Mississippi in this distance one would set out from Tadotsu bearing 37.2°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Vicksburg, Mississippi bearing 143.7° or SE .
- Both have a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Vicksburg, Mississippi is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Tadotsu is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 3.3 °C (5.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.6 °C (6.5°F) less in Vicksburg, Mississippi.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 119.7 mm (4.7 in) more which is equivalent to 119.7 l/m² (2.94 US gal/ft²) or 1,197,000 l/ha (127,967 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.9° higher in Vicksburg, Mississippi than in Tadotsu.
- Relative humidity levels are 12.6%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 0.1°C (0.1°F) higher.
